From: Gender and task type effects on the neural network of emotional prosody processing

Fig. 2: Gender effects on emotional prosody activation network.

A The activation networks of EP processing (including EP, EEP and IEP) and the overlap of EEP and IEP based on female cohorts (left) and male cohorts (right) respectively. B The spatial correlation between unthresholded activation networks. C The overlap maps of female and male for EP, EEP and IEP. O-EP, F-EP, M-EP: Emotional prosody activation networks for overall, female and male cohort; O-EEP, F-EEP, M-EEP: Explicit emotional prosody activation networks for overall, female and male cohort; O-IEP, F-IEP, M-IEP: Implicit emotional prosody activation networks for overall, female and male cohort.
